Harry Potter and the Deathly Hallows

Author: J.K. Rowling

“Harry Potter and the Deathly Hallows” by J.K. Rowling is a thrilling conclusion to the beloved series. As Harry, Hermione, and Ron embark on a perilous quest to destroy Voldemort’s Horcruxes, the stakes have never been higher. About J.K. Rowling

J.K. Rowling, born Joanne Rowling on July 31, 1965, is a British author best known for creating the Harry Potter series, which has become a global phenomenon. The final book in the series, Harry Potter and the Deathly Hallows, was published in 2007 and concluded the epic tale of the young wizard Harry Potter and his battle against the dark wizard Voldemort. Rowling’s imaginative storytelling, rich character development, and intricate plotting have captivated millions of readers worldwide. Beyond her literary achievements, Rowling has made significant contributions to literacy and charity, founding the Volant Charitable Trust and Lumos, an organization dedicated to supporting disadvantaged children. Her work has not only transformed the landscape of children’s literature but has also left an indelible mark on popular culture.
